Water main repair services involve fixing or replacing the underground pipe that supplies water from the municipal system to a property. These repairs are essential when the water main develops leaks, cracks, or other types of damage that can disrupt water flow or cause water to escape into the ground. Skilled service providers use specialized equipment to locate the exact point of damage and perform repairs efficiently, minimizing disruption to the property and surrounding area. Proper repair work helps ensure a reliable water supply and prevents further issues that could lead to costly repairs or water damage.
Problems that often signal the need for water main repair include frequent leaks, reduced water pressure, discolored water, or unexplained increases in water bills. In some cases, visible signs like pooling water or sinkholes near the property may indicate a more serious underground leak. Older pipes, ground shifting, corrosion, or accidental damage from construction activities can all cause water mains to fail. The overview below groups typical Water Main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Wichita, KS.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or water main repairs in Wichita range from $250 to $600. Many routine fixes fall within this range, covering issues like small leaks or localized pipe repairs. Larger or more complex repairs can sometimes exceed this range.
Moderate Repairs - For moderate water main repairs involving partial pipe replacements or extensive patching, local contractors often charge between $600 and $2,000. Most projects of this scope tend to land in the middle of this range, depending on pipe access and damage extent.
Full Replacement - Replacing an entire water main pipe usually costs between $3,000 and $7,000 in Wichita, with larger or more complicated projects reaching $8,000 or more. Many full replacements fall into this higher tier, especially in cases requiring trenchless technology or deep excavations.
Complex or Emergency Jobs - Larger, more complex projects or emergency repairs can range from $5,000 to $15,000 or higher. These jobs often involve additional factors like roadwork, permits, or difficult access, which can significantly influence the final cost. Many of these projects are less common but necessary in severe cases.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What causes water main leaks or breaks? Water main issues can result from corrosion, ground shifting, freezing temperatures, or age-related deterioration, leading to leaks or breaks in the pipe system.
How can I tell if my water main needs repair? Signs include low water pressure, frequent leaks, discolored water, or visible damage to the pipe or surrounding area.
What types of water main repair services are available? Local contractors may offer pipe patching, pipe replacement, or complete water main rerouting depending on the extent of the damage.
